About Technology Transactions Law in Tijuana, Mexico

Technology Transactions involve the negotiation and drafting of agreements related to the transfer, licensing, or sale of technology and intellectual property rights. In Tijuana, Mexico, these transactions are governed by specific laws and regulations that protect the rights of both parties involved.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the difference between a technology transfer and a technology license?

A technology transfer involves the outright transfer of technology or intellectual property rights, while a technology license grants permission to use the technology under specific conditions.

2. What essential clauses should be included in a technology transaction agreement?

Key clauses to include in a technology transaction agreement are intellectual property rights, confidentiality, warranties, payment terms, and dispute resolution mechanisms.

3. How can I protect my intellectual property during a technology transaction?

You can protect your intellectual property by clearly defining ownership rights in the agreement, including confidentiality clauses, and registering your intellectual property with the appropriate authorities.

4. What should I do if a dispute arises during a technology transaction?

If a dispute arises, it is advised to first attempt to resolve the issue through negotiation or mediation. If unsuccessful, you may need to seek legal assistance to escalate the matter through litigation.

5. Can I engage in international technology transactions in Tijuana, Mexico?

Yes, you can engage in international technology transactions in Tijuana, Mexico, but it is essential to consider the applicable laws of both countries involved in the transaction.

6. How long does it take to finalize a technology transaction agreement?

The timeline for finalizing a technology transaction agreement can vary depending on the complexity of the terms, negotiations between parties, and any legal requirements that need to be satisfied.

7. What is the role of regulatory authorities in overseeing technology transactions in Tijuana, Mexico?

Regulatory authorities in Tijuana, Mexico may oversee technology transactions to ensure compliance with intellectual property laws, data protection regulations, and fair competition practices.

8. Are there any tax implications associated with technology transactions in Tijuana, Mexico?

Yes, there may be tax implications related to technology transactions, such as income tax on royalties, value-added tax on services, and withholding taxes on payments to non-residents.

Additional Resources

For additional resources on Technology Transactions in Tijuana, Mexico, you may refer to the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I) and the National Institute of Copyright (INDAUTOR) for information and guidance on intellectual property rights.
